About Gray Media
Today, we are a growing multimedia company head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ia. We are the nation's largest owner of top-rated local television stations and digital assets serving 117 full‑power television markets that collectively reach approximately 37% of U.S. television households. The portfolio includes 80 markets with the top‑rated television station and 100 markets with the first and/or second highest rated television station in average all‑day ratings across 116 of such markets that were measured by Nielsen in 2025.
We also own the largest Telemundo Affiliate group with 47 markets and Gray Digital Media, a full‑service digital agency offering national and local clients digital marketing strategies with the most advanced digital products and services. Our additional media properties include video production companies Raycom Sports, Tupelo Media Group, and Power Nation Studios, and studio production facilities Assembly Atlanta and Third Rail Studios.
WTVA
WTVA is the news, weather, and sports leader in Northeast Mississippi. We are the NBC and ABC affiliates in our market. We cover 19 counties across Northeast Mississippi and West Alabama.
